US Layoffs Hit 4-Year Low in August

Layoffs Fall, But Hiring Falters: What's Behind the Numbers? The latest labor data shows U. S.

layoffs have fallen to their lowest level in four years, a trend that should bring relief to those concerned about job security. However, hiring is sluggish, and companies remain hesitant to fill open positions.

One reason for the low layoff numbers may be that many businesses have already trimmed their workforces significantly over the past few years.
